Acoustic Guitar ( s ): 2012 Gibson J-45 Standard with LR Baggs Element Active Pickup The J45 is a workhorse acoustic . It sounds great live and records super well . This has been my main acoustic for leading worship and playing in bands for the past 12 years .
2015 Martin CEO-7 with K & K Pure Mini Pickup This is actually my wife ’ s guitar , but I steal it as often as I can because it is the best sounding small-body acoustic that I ’ ve ever played . The K & K Pure Mini is also a really great sounding pickup that doesn ’ t require any batteries and doesn ’ t take away from the guitar ’ s natural tone .
Electric Guitar ( s ): PRS SE DGT The SE DGT is my newest guitar , but I am a huge fan . I think this is one of the best sub $ 1k guitars that you can buy right now . You can get so many great tones out of it , and the coil-taps on these pickups actually sound great .
2014 Fender Classic Player Jazzmaster Special The Jazzmaster is such a unique and awesome design . From the pickups to the offset shape , I ’ ve always been drawn to these guitars . The tremolo system , when setup correctly , is my favorite of all the options out there .
2006 American Fender Telecaster The Telecaster is such a simple yet versatile guitar , and I think it really shines in the context of modern worship . The tone of a Tele running into an AC30 just roars and cuts so well in a mix . If I could only have one guitar it would be a Tele .
